Canadian Household Debt On the Rise
2008-07-17 16:02:00 The level of household debt has been steadily increasing for the last 20 years in Canada so it should be no surprise that it continued to rise again this quarter. The average Canadian household now has an average of 19.6 cents of debt for every dollar of networth and household debt is averaging about 123.8% of personal disposable income. This is a frightening figure at this stage of the financial cycle as it is much more likely that interest rates will be rising than decreasing. An increase in interest rates will of course make managing this debt much more difficult for many Canadian households. How does your household debt compare to your personal disposable income?

Get Rid Of Ants Without An Exterminator [Household]
2008-06-09 05:00:00 Has warm weather brought a plague of ants down upon your home? We’ve talked about deterring ants with baby powder, but frugal blog fivecentnickel.com shares the following more aggressive method: First, pick up some boric acid powder (available at most drug stores) and mix a small amount of it 50:50 with table sugar. There’s nothing particularly scientific about this ratio, so it’s fine to just eyeball it. Next, put some of this mix into a small container such as the the cap from a milk jug or the lid from a 2 liter bottle. Finally, drizzle some water into it to make a slurry (i.e., a thick suspension). That’s it — you’re now ready to kill some ants. Some ants feed off fats and grease instead of sweets, so you can make this mixture with peanut butter instead of sugar should the first round of ant warfare prove ineffective. Study finds lead in household dust
2008-06-04 06:19:00 CHENNAI: Children across the country are exposed to lead poisoning even in their homes, according to a study conducted by an environmental NGO, which was unveiled on Friday.The organisation, Toxics Link, found alarmingly high levels of lead in household dust in New Delhi, with wall paint being the main source.Dust wipe samples were collected from floors and window sills in 57 households in Delhi ? and 31% of the samples of floor dust and 14% of the window sill dust samples contained levels of lead that would be considered hazardous by the US Environment Protection Agency."While the study, ?Dusty toxics: A study on lead in household dust in Delhi,' has been done in only one city, the situation is likely to be similar in other Indian cities. We will be conducting a similar study in Chennai by December," says G Arun Senthil Ram, programme coordinator, Toxics Link, Chennai.
